When a Structural Inspection Makes a Condo Less Safe

New Jersey condominium building highlighting concerns about structural inspection quality and building safety

New Jersey required structural inspections to prevent another catastrophic building failure. But as condominium associations receive reassuring reports despite serious deterioration, an uncomfortable question is emerging: What happens when an inspection provides confidence without providing safety?

In the years since the collapse of Champlain Towers South in Surfside, Florida, few people involved with aging condominium buildings have questioned the need for better structural oversight. The disaster demonstrated in the starkest possible terms that deterioration can progress for years while owners debate repairs, defer expenditures and underestimate what is happening inside a building.

New Jersey responded with P.L. 2023, c.214, legislation requiring periodic structural inspections of certain condominium and cooperative buildings. It was an understandable response to a real problem. Buildings age. Concrete deteriorates. Steel corrodes. Waterproofing fails. Foundations move. Balconies and parking structures endure decades of exposure. A system that forces these conditions to be examined before they become emergencies should make buildings safer.

But that assumes something fundamental: that the inspections themselves are adequate.

Over the past several years, our work has increasingly brought us to condominium properties that have already been evaluated by another engineering firm. More recently, many of those properties have undergone the structural inspections now required in New Jersey. The associations often hand us the reports with considerable confidence. They have done what the law required. An engineer has inspected the property. Nothing significant was identified. From the board’s perspective, one of the largest uncertainties surrounding an aging building has been resolved.

Then we inspect the building.

At more than a dozen properties, we have encountered conditions that are difficult to reconcile with the reassurance provided by the previous structural evaluation. Some differences between engineers are inevitable; existing-building engineering is not an exact science, and reasonable professionals can disagree about the significance of a condition or the appropriate timing of a repair. That is not what concerns us.

What concerns us are buildings where significant indicators of structural distress appear to have gone largely unaddressed.

At one approximately 40-unit condominium property, the evidence of building movement was extensive enough to affect the building’s operation. Floors were cracked. Sliding doors would no longer function correctly. There were significant indications of foundation settlement. Elsewhere at the same property, cantilevered structural beams exhibited deterioration, corrosion and deflection.

The association had recently received an engineering evaluation from a large firm. The report identified no structural repairs as necessary. Among the limited work it did recommend was replacement of siding at an upper chimney.

The contrast was remarkable. An association had hired an engineering firm for the purpose of understanding the structural condition of its building, yet conditions affecting the foundation and structural framing remained while a nonstructural siding item made its way into the recommendations.

The association did not believe it was ignoring its building. Quite the opposite. It believed it had done the responsible thing.

That distinction is at the center of the problem.

We encountered a similar situation at a large condominium property in North Jersey. The association had recently completed its structural evaluation and understood that evaluation to be reassuring. When we subsequently became involved, we found significant deficiencies within the parking structure that required serious attention.

Again, the troubling part was not simply the existence of deterioration. Deterioration in an aging parking structure is neither unusual nor necessarily evidence that someone has failed. The troubling part was the difference between the conditions we observed and the level of confidence the association had been given about its property.

After seeing variations of this scenario repeatedly, it is becoming difficult to treat them as isolated experiences.

The problem with a passing report

There is a peculiar risk created by mandatory inspections that is easy to overlook.

Before an inspection, uncertainty is visible. A board may know that its building is 30, 40 or 50 years old. Members may see cracks in concrete, rust on steel or water entering a garage and wonder what else they do not know. Uncertainty creates discomfort, and that discomfort can prompt investigation.

A reassuring engineering report changes the psychology of the building.

The next time a crack appears, someone can say the building was just inspected. When a door begins binding, the explanation may be that old buildings move. When corrosion becomes visible, there is less urgency because an engineer recently evaluated the structure. The report becomes the answer to questions that may not actually have been answered.

This is why a poor structural inspection has the potential to be more consequential than no inspection at all.

No inspection provides no assurance.

An inadequate inspection can provide false assurance.

And false assurance changes behavior.

It can influence whether a board authorizes additional investigation, whether repairs are accelerated or deferred, how reserve funds are allocated and how seriously future warning signs are treated. It can also influence what hundreds of unit owners believe about the building in which they live.

The words we just had the structural inspection carry enormous weight in a condominium boardroom.

They should.

The question is whether the system now developing in New Jersey consistently justifies that confidence.

A law can require an inspection. It cannot make the inspection good.

New Jersey’s legislation does not contemplate a meaningless walk-through. The law addresses the primary load-bearing system of covered buildings and requires a written report describing its condition and identifying necessary maintenance or repairs. It also calls for inspections to follow a protocol established by the American Society of Civil Engineers or a similar nationally recognized structural engineering organization.

On paper, that is a substantial obligation.

In practice, however, the quality of an existing-building investigation depends heavily on the person performing it, the amount of time spent at the property, the areas made accessible, the records reviewed, the conditions recognized and, perhaps most importantly, whether the engineer is willing to acknowledge when a visual observation is insufficient to reach a conclusion.

Existing buildings rarely present themselves neatly.

A steel beam may disappear into a wall precisely where water has been entering for years. A concrete surface can appear relatively intact while reinforcing steel corrodes below it. A coating may conceal deterioration. A balcony connection may be inaccessible. Foundation movement may first reveal itself through cracked finishes, uneven floors or doors that no longer fit their openings.

The answer to those conditions cannot always be found by looking harder.

Sometimes a probe is necessary. Sometimes concrete needs to be sounded. Sometimes measurements need to be taken and monitored. Sometimes historical drawings and repair records need to be reviewed. Sometimes finishes have to be opened. Sometimes testing is appropriate.

And sometimes the most important sentence an engineer can put in a report is not no repairs are required.

It is: We cannot determine the condition of this component without further investigation.

There is no professional weakness in saying that. Existing-building engineering requires recognizing the boundary between what is known and what is merely assumed.

Who checks the inspectors?

That leads to a question New Jersey may not yet have adequately answered.

If these reports are important enough for the state to require them, what mechanism ensures that the inspections behind them are meaningful?

A condominium board cannot realistically perform that function. Most board members are volunteers. Even a sophisticated board cannot be expected to determine whether an engineer adequately evaluated structural steel section loss, differential foundation movement, concrete deterioration or a concealed balcony connection.

A property manager cannot be expected to peer-review structural engineering.

The residents cannot do it.

The report therefore carries extraordinary authority precisely because almost everyone receiving it lacks the expertise to independently challenge it.

New Jersey requires reports to be provided to specified officials and enforcing agencies, but the existence of a filing requirement should not be confused with substantive engineering review. The state’s own implementation guidance raises important questions about the role local enforcing agencies actually play in enforcement of the structural integrity requirements.

This is the gap that deserves greater attention.

The state has created a system in which an engineering report can materially affect how a condominium association understands the safety of its building. Yet if an inspection fails to identify significant observable distress, there may be no practical second layer of review that catches the problem.

That is a dangerous place for any safety program to end.

The Jersey Shore makes the stakes higher

The issue is especially important in New Jersey’s coastal condominium communities.

From Long Beach Island through Atlantic City, Ventnor, Margate, Longport, Ocean City, the Wildwoods and Cape May, thousands of condominium units exist in buildings exposed to conditions that are particularly unforgiving of deferred maintenance.

Salt and moisture attack steel. Water finds failed joints and membranes. Chlorides accelerate reinforcement corrosion. Concrete cracks and spalls. Balcony edges deteriorate. Embedded metals corrode. Parking structures receive both coastal exposure and salts carried in by vehicles during winter. Small waterproofing failures can become structural repair projects when they are allowed to persist long enough.

North Jersey has a different building inventory but many of the same underlying problems: aging concrete garages, large multifamily structures, decades of repairs and alterations, water intrusion and buildings whose structural systems are partially concealed by architectural finishes.

The purpose of periodic structural inspection is particularly compelling in these environments.

Which is why the quality of those inspections matters so much.

The state should be asking a second question

The first question New Jersey asked after Surfside was essentially: Are we inspecting these buildings?

It was the right question.

Several years into implementation, the state should begin asking another:

Are the inspections working?

That does not require turning every structural report into a government engineering project. Nor does it require assuming that every disagreement between engineers represents a deficient inspection.

But a credible safety system needs feedback.

The state could audit a sample of submitted reports. It could establish clearer expectations for documenting the structural systems actually observed and areas that could not be accessed. Reports could distinguish explicitly between components observed to be satisfactory and components whose condition could not be determined. Photographic documentation could establish what was inspected at the time of the evaluation.

More importantly, certain observations—significant settlement, structural deflection, advanced corrosion, concrete deterioration or substantial displacement—should be difficult to close out with a conclusory statement when the underlying cause has not been established.

There should also be a way for the system to learn from major discrepancies. If substantial structural deterioration is discovered shortly after a required inspection reported no need for structural repair, that should be useful information. Not necessarily for punishment, but for determining whether inspection standards, guidance or oversight need to improve.

A system that never examines its misses cannot know how often it is missing.

The smoldering problem

None of this is an argument against New Jersey’s structural inspection law.

The state was right to act.

The greater danger would be assuming that passage of the law solved the problem it was designed to address.

Structural deterioration does not care whether a report has been filed. Corrosion continues beneath paint. Water continues through failed membranes. Foundations continue to move. Concrete continues to deteriorate.

A report changes none of those things unless the inspection accurately identifies the conditions and the findings lead to appropriate action.

That is what makes the pattern we are seeing so concerning.

A condominium with obvious deterioration and no structural inspection has a problem that everyone can understand: the building has not been adequately evaluated.

A condominium with the same deterioration and a reassuring structural report has a much more complicated problem.

The owners believe it has.

The board believes it has.

The manager believes it has.

The report is in the file.

The statutory requirement has been satisfied.

And somewhere inside the building, the deterioration continues.

That is the smoldering problem New Jersey should be paying attention to.

The success of the state’s structural integrity law should not ultimately be measured by how many inspections are completed or how many reports are filed. It should be measured by whether significant structural deterioration is being found early enough to do something about it.

New Jersey has taken an important step by requiring aging condominium buildings to be examined.

Now it needs to make sure that being inspected and being safe do not become mistaken for the same thing.
